Writer / educator

Location: Remote

Employment Type: Freelance, part-time or full-time

About us

SuperGuide.com.au is a superannuation and retirement planning information website visited by millions of Australians each year. We are an independent media company whose mission is to educate Australian consumers about making the most of their super and plan for retirement.

About the work

One of the many benefits of working with SuperGuide is that the content we produce is completely independent and unbiased, produced solely with the readers’ best interests at heart.

Topics you’ll cover include superannuation, self-managed super funds, retirement planning, Age Pension, tax and investing. You don’t need to be an expert across all these topics, but a solid understanding is essential.

SuperGuide focuses less on ‘news’ and more on covering superannuation and related topics in depth. Often these are how-to guides and checklists incorporating strategies, tips, Q&As and case studies, but we are increasingly educating our audience using more audio-visual aids such as webinars, videos and podcasts.

About you

SuperGuide is looking for writers and financial educators to write and update content on the website, ensuring it is comprehensive, up to date, accurate and high quality.

Working both independently and collaboratively with other expert writers, you will be able to simplify dry and complex topics, making them easier to understand and actionable.

You will have experience writing and developing content that educates everyday Australians about superannuation and retirement in engaging ways, ideally through tools such as calculators, videos, checklists, courses, webinars and podcasts.

The role offers great flexibility. You can work full time or part time, hours that suit you, and either work from home anywhere in Australia or in our office in Sydney.

Qualifications, skills and experience required include:

  • A passion for superannuation education and financial literacy
  • A good understanding of financial advice principles and processes, particularly around planning for retirement
  • Solid writing experience

Not essential but highly desirable:

  • 3 or more years’ experience in the superannuation industry
  • Good working knowledge of WordPress
  • Experience producing videos, podcasts, courses and webinars
  • A tertiary qualification in journalism, communication or related field
  • RG146 qualified
  • SMSF knowledge
